Catalog description

An introduction to the physical nature and processes of the earth, along with the chemical bases for them. Dynamic processes of landscape formation and change as shaped by the forces of plate tectonics, weather, and ground and surface water will be studied. Studio style hands on activities will complement lectures. This class is structured to meet the requirements of PI 34.022(2) for Educator Licensing with WI DPI.
